Places to stay in Suffolk
Suffolk has places to stay for every kind of break, whether you’re planning a coastal escape, a countryside pause or a few nights in a characterful town. Choose from cottages, B&Bs, hotels, holiday parks and glamping, with options for couples, families and dog owners. Many stays make a great base for easy days out, with walks from the door, local food close by and space to slow down in the evenings. If you’re drawn to the coast, you’ll find places to stay near beaches and footpaths, perfect for early strolls and sea air. Prefer something quieter? Inland Suffolk offers village stays and rural hideaways where the pace naturally softens.
